Teach a Free Community Art Class

The Frankfort Arts Association is seeking passionate teaching artists to partner with us in offering free art programs that inspire, connect, and uplift our community.

 

Through grant funding, FAA will pay artists for their time and materials, while local non-profit partners—such as The Bridge Teen Center and The Cancer Support Center—provide the venue, participants, and administrative support.

This collaborative model allows us to bring meaningful art experiences to diverse audiences while supporting fellow community organizations.

 

How the Program Works

 

This partnership model is designed to maximize community impact while keeping things simple for everyone involved.

Here’s how it benefits you as a teaching artist:

  • No Administrative Hassle: You get to focus on what you do best—teaching and inspiring through art. Our partner organizations handle registration, participant communication, and scheduling.

  • Guaranteed Payment: FAA will cover your professional fee and the cost of supplies, funded through community grants.

  • Meaningful Reach: Your class will directly serve audiences in need—whether that’s teens, families, adults, or cancer support participants—through trusted local organizations.

  • Mission in Action: Together, we’ll make art accessible to all and strengthen community connections through creativity.

 

What’s Expected of Artists

  • You’ll bring all necessary materials and supplies for your program.

  • Proposed costs should include your teaching fee and supplies.

  • FAA will pay the total approved amount using grant funds once your proposal is accepted.

  • You’ll work directly with our partner host on scheduling and setup details.

We also ask our partner organizations to help us document the impact of these programs through attendance numbers and participant feedback—valuable data that helps us grow this initiative and secure future funding.
